Race to find
Lost champions
Displaced colleagues
Beloved coaches
Forlorn friends
From an era gone by
Ring the sound
Of glory for the team
Ring the sound
Of glory to learn
The prize is not
The ring at all
The prize is you, my friend
The friend who loves you
Who cheers the champion
And finds the colleagues
Mourns the era gone by
Melts away 50 years
Holds the class as one
Even across country
–Victoria Emmons, 2014
(Inspired by the Robert E. Lee High School Class of 1968 whose track team won the State Cross Country Championship, never got the recognition it deserved until 2014 when a reunion was organized by fellow classmates and a champion ring was given to each member of the team.)
